Output 6fc8520b3473dcec4946c8f06e656f6cc3f3a94566e1dd9bd8d92afa688075ce:1

value
2994572998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1c8ae4f8507bfdf911ba843200b45ff01bd088 OP_EQUAL
address
3P8Auo6FhhwqQrWWKyEvSY5NUbxePkZtAq
transaction
6fc8520b3473dcec4946c8f06e656f6cc3f3a94566e1dd9bd8d92afa688075ce
confirmations
384859
spent
true